Serving 177 students in grades Kindergarten-5, Rufino Vigo ranks in the top 30% of all schools in Puerto Rico for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 50%, and reading proficiency is top 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 30-34% (which is higher than the Puerto Rico state average of 23%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 40-44% (which is higher than the Puerto Rico state average of 36%).
The student-teacher ratio of 6:1 is lower than the Puerto Rico state level of 10:1.

School Overview

Rufino Vigo's student population of 177 students has declined by 19% over five school years.
The teacher population of 30 teachers has grown by 57% over five school years.
